North Central College is honoringWilliam D. Soper '68 with Outstanding Alumni Award with a 2013 Outstanding Alumni Award.
William D. Soper, M.D. ’68 is a board-certified general surgeon with more than twenty five years of experience in the practice of general surgery. He received his medical degree from University of Illinois College of Medicine in Chicago and completed his surgical residency at the University of Illinois Medical Center.
Dr. Soper also completed a two-year Fellowship in Transplant Surgery at Massachusetts General Hospital in Boston. Following his training, Dr. Soper served as Director of the Surgical Intensive Care Unit at the University of Illinois Medical Group and as Associate Director of Transplantation at Northwestern Memorial Hospital for 12 years. He has been practicing general surgery in the northwest suburbs since 1994 and has held several leadership positions at area hospitals including Chief of General Surgery at Northwest Community Hospital and President of the Illinois Transplant Society.
Additionally, he has held leadership positions in many other local and national organizations including the American Society of Transplant Surgeons and the American Cancer Society Reach to Recovery Program. He has published numerous articles in national journals in the areas of transplantation and general surgery and is a member of many national surgical societies. Dr. Soper is experienced in all types of general surgery with special interest in dialysis access surgery, hernia, breast, gallbladder and colon surgery as well as advanced laparoscopic surgery of the abdomen.
